Hotel overview
The magical Mexican resort region of Los Cabos is home to Nobu’s first hotel in Mexico.
Sitting on the southernmost tip of the Baja Peninsula, Nobu Hotel Los Cabos has mesmerizing views of sparkling sapphire waters, stretching as far as the eye can see. The hotel offers 200 guest rooms and suites, ample meeting and event spaces, a luxurious spa, retail shopping, infinity pools, private cabanas, and a variety of bars and dining, including a Nobu restaurant on the beach.

General policies & fine print
Check-in Policy - Hotel requires a credit/debit card authorization or cash deposit upon check-in for incidentals; this will place a hold on your funds.
Convention Policy - Individuals attending a convention cannot book this property for their stay. If found attending a convention, guests may be subject to higher room rates upon arrival.
Hotel Spring Break Policy - This hotel cannot guarantee a spring-break-free environment.
Student Groups (Spring Breakers) are not permitted at Hotel. A student group consist of those that travel without parent supervision or a responsible adult in each room. This could refer to but not limited to high school students or college students booking multiple rooms.
Transfer Policy - A price may display when children stay free, if your vacation includes transfer to your hotel.
General Information - Room taxes are included in vacation price. Minimum night stay restrictions may apply. Reservation changes may not be permitted unless authorized by the hotel.
A maximum of two pets are allowed per room. The hotel is not responsible for providing food for pets due to each pet's particular diet/eating habits. The pet friendly program allows for each pet to be a maximum weight of 48.5lbs and a height of 15.7in. The program requires a fee of 150USD plus tax per pet, per stay. The hotel will not provide kennels or crates.

Best family vacation with baby accommodations
We had the sweetest family vacation and anniversary trip at Nobu Cabo! We stayed there before and knew we had to come back again, now with our daughter. We always love the friendly service, clean and comfortable rooms. This time we requested extra baby accommodations during our stay and the hospitality went above and beyond! They supplied a crib, baby bath tub, mini fridge to keep her milk cold and microwave to reheat our food. I’m so impressed by this service because it’s not offered anywhere else. Also, our concierge Michelle Ponce greeted us on day one and was super friendly, checking in on our daily needs and even helped us book a last minute private airport car service. She made our trip very easy and seamlessly. We are looking forward to coming back soon!

Not worth the cost. Service is suffering.
We have loved Nobu in the past. The resort and service have gone downhill since our last visit. Booked a birthday trip for my wife and booked the birthday package which included a room upgrade. We arrived at 1 pm and did t get in the room until 8 pm with our bags. They offered us champagne as a reconcile but we don’t drink so they took it away and that was it. On her birthday we booked a massage. The room was ice cold and e couldn’t move because it was a couples room. We froze the entire time. Afterward there was no hot water in either locker room and the hot tub was broken. We asked for maid service multiple times before we left the room for the day and returned to not having the fresh room. More apologies but not changing experience. At the end we were offered no reconciliation and when I mentioned our displeasure we met a manager who did take some of our food bill away, although we didn’t get close to our food service minimum anyway on the birthday package. The resort is staffed with junior managers so you can tell they’ve lost trained personnel to other high end resorts. Overall you can do much better for the cost. We won’t be returning.
